    There was a thread within the last week where the a no win no fee solicitor would not take on a case involving CIGA. I suspect this is because CIGA are thought to not have much money. Also because CIGA are notorious for not giving speedy, genuine responses.

    This means you would be approaching CIGA. I have done this, and I gained a settlement, of sorts.

    Were CIGA competent in dealing with the claim? Here I would give them zero out of ten.

    Did I expect anything different? Yes, because CIGA know how bad their reputation is, so I gave them the opportunity to show that this poor reputation was not always justified.

    Should consumers pursue claims against CIGA? That opens up a can of worms, but I sense the mindset in CIGA is that consumers should not.

    Did you check the "surveyor"s qualifications?

    It might not be a scam but they will probably just be case farms. They stick in the paper work and hope for a settlement which they take half of. The amount of work they do on your case will be near to nothing.


    What is your problem with your insulation?
    If you have damp it's probably better just to fix wherever the water is getting in to your house than to complain about the insulation.

    "Surveyors" for that read scam artists, canvass innocent consumers trying to convince them they should not have decided to have CWI installed. These "surveyors" then find faults that the consumer was never aware of, and with sales spin suck them in.

    Genuine claims to CIGA come from genuine people who raise genuine concerns. For this simple procedure there are no costs involved.

    Anyone can win in a claim against CIGA, but do not think it is a "compo" game. CIGA have next to no money, so there is almost no compo available.

    But legal sharks enter the stage thinking they can get rich by hijacking this system.
